Tokyo GA Flying
 
Hello,

I will be spending a few months in Tokyo on a university exchange program and was wondering if anyone had any information about the GA scene around the city. I know it could be difficult. I have an EASA PPL (A) license and fly DA20-A1 and DA40NG. As I am only in Tokyo temporarily, I am not looking for a conversion, rather a method to log a few training hours under PU/T and see how the GA current flying atmosphere is. I am not looking for P1 flying at the moment. I am happy if even someone suggests a flying club with an instructor that I can go up with for a few hours.

I understand that if someone has a foreign license, they cannot touch the controls of a JA registered aircraft, but what happens when a student pilot flies with an instructor (say on their first lesson)? Can’t the instructor give them the controls, even if it is for a few seconds or minutes?

From Tokyo, I see Chofu is relatively close. I also see there is an airstrip to the North of the city, but I currently do not have much information on either.
